Ejector Pump Installation in Huntsville, AL
Ejector pump installation services provide a solution for property owners who need to move wastewater from lower to higher elevations, especially in homes with bas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other plumbing fixtures located below the main sewer line. These systems are designed to handle waste and greywater efficiently, making them suitable for projects where gravity drainage alone is insufficient. Homeowners typically request ejector pump installations when renovating or constructing new plumbing setups, or when existing systems require replacement or upgrades to ensure proper sewage management.
Before requesting ejector pump install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the type of pump suitable for their property size and plumbing needs, as well as the space available for installation. It is also helpful to consider the electrical requirements and any necessary modifications to existing plumbing or flooring. Clarifying these details can ensure the system functions reliably and meets the specific needs of the home, providing peace of mind for ongoing wastewater management.

Ejector Pump Installation Questions
What is an ejector pump used for? An ejector pump helps remove wastewater from lower-level areas or basement bathrooms where gravity drainage isn't possible.
Where are ejector pumps typically installed? They are usually installed in basement or crawl space areas to manage sewage or wastewater from fixtures below main sewer lines.
What are common signs that an ejector pump needs installation? Signs include slow drainage, foul odors, or frequent pump cycling indicating the system may be failing or needs to be added.
What property types benefit from ejector pump installation? Ejector pumps are suitable for residential basements, home additions, or any property with below-grade plumbing fixtures.
